Subterranean Termite Soil & Slab Trenching Defense in San Antonio, TX

Subterranean Termite Soil & Slab Trenching Defense

Continuous non-repellent liquid termiticide applications engineered to eliminate Formosan and Eastern subterranean termite colonies foraging beneath concrete slab foundations and pier-and-beam subfloors. Technicians trench along exterior foundation perimeters, drill specialized access portals through adjoining flatwork patios and garage slabs, and inject measured liquid barriers into sub-slab soil. This chemistry adheres to local caliche and clay soil particles, allowing foraging termites to unknowingly pass through the active agent and transfer the lethal active ingredient back to the central subterranean queen through social grooming and trophallaxis, halting structural wood consumption.

Striped Bark Scorpion Exclusion & Microencapsulated Barrier Defense in San Antonio, TX

Striped Bark Scorpion Exclusion & Microencapsulated Barrier Defense

Targeted exterior defense protocols designed to eliminate Centruroides vittatus from residential structures across northern and western Bexar County. Service includes applying UV-stable microencapsulated liquid formulations along the bottom 3 feet of exterior masonry foundations, installing breathable woven copper mesh or galvanized inserts into open brick weep holes, and treating crawlspace retaining walls. Technicians conduct detailed nighttime ultraviolet blacklight inspections to map harborage clusters in rock retaining walls, flagstone patios, and exterior landscape borders, applying long-lasting contact dusts within expansion joints to eliminate scorpions before they migrate into baseboards and bedrooms.

German Cockroach Cleanout & Insect Growth Regulator Remediation in San Antonio, TX

German Cockroach Cleanout & Insect Growth Regulator Remediation

Systematic eradication program formulated for high-density infestations of Blattella germanica in residential kitchens, pantries, and multi-unit housing complexes. The treatment combines highly palatable non-repellent matrix baits containing abamectin or indoxacarb with juvenile hormone mimics that arrest the reproductive molting process of nymphal instars. Technicians apply targeted micro-injections directly into hidden cabinet hinges, electrical junction housings, hollow appliance framework legs, and wall void plumbing chaseways, rapidly neutralizing reproductive cycles without dispersing broad-spectrum airborne chemicals across open living zones.

American & Smokybrown Cockroach Perimeter Abatement in San Antonio, TX

American & Smokybrown Cockroach Perimeter Abatement

Targeted suppression of large peridomestic roach species that harbor in municipal sewer lines, mulch beds, tree canopies, and water meter boxes. Technicians deploy water-resistant granular baits across exterior mulched landscape perimeters, inject moisture-resistant residual formulations into sub-grade utility vaults, and establish a continuous chemical barrier around crawlspace access doors and foundation vents. Mechanical exclusion measures include sealing gaps around exterior hose bibbs, air conditioning condensation drain lines, and oversized utility conduit openings to stop migrating adults from penetrating interior baseboards.

Roof Rat Structural Exclusion & Attic Decontamination in San Antonio, TX

Roof Rat Structural Exclusion & Attic Decontamination

Complete mechanical animal exclusion and biological sanitization protocol targeting Rattus rattus populations inhabiting attic insulation, cathedral ceilings, and soffit voids. Technicians map roofline transitions, ridge vents, gable louvers, and plumbing stack flashings, permanently sealing all breaches larger than one-quarter inch with 23-gauge galvanized steel mesh, copper mesh, and elastomeric structural sealants. Heavy snap-trapping arrays within non-living attic zones rapidly extract remaining animals, followed by the vacuum extraction of localized droppings and the application of an enzyme-based sanitizing aerosol to neutralize pheromone trails and pathogenic biological residues.

Bed Bug Precision Heat & Targeted Insecticide Remediation in San Antonio, TX

Bed Bug Precision Heat & Targeted Insecticide Remediation

Multi-phase biological eradication program targeting Cimex lectularius in residential bedrooms, guest suites, and hospitality facilities. The remediation integrates high-temperature localized thermal dry-steam application along mattress seams, upholstered furniture frames, and baseboard crevices, followed by precision liquid applications of dual-action residual insecticides and amorphous silica desiccant dusts within electrical switch plates and hollow wall cavities. This multi-modal approach eliminates active adults and nymphs while piercing the protective outer lipid layers of insect egg clusters, preventing delayed hatching cycles and ongoing occupant bites.

Seasonal Mosquito Reduction & Larvicide Barrier Treatment in San Antonio, TX

Seasonal Mosquito Reduction & Larvicide Barrier Treatment

Comprehensive yard-wide vector suppression targeting Aedes aegypti and Culex quinquefasciatus mosquitoes across suburban properties from March through November. Technicians utilize backpack mist blowers to apply microencapsulated residual formulations directly to the underside of dense foliage, tree canopies, covered patios, and shaded foundation recesses where adult mosquitoes rest during extreme daylight heat. Concurrently, biological Bacillus thuringiensis israelensis (Bti) larvicide briquettes or granular treatments are placed in non-draining catch basins, French drain cleanouts, and standing decorative water features to stop juvenile mosquito larvae from maturing into biting adults.

Red Imported Fire Ant Yard Elimination & Deep Turf Baiting in San Antonio, TX

Red Imported Fire Ant Yard Elimination & Deep Turf Baiting

Broad-scale property broadcast treatments combined with targeted mound injections to permanently suppress Solenopsis invicta across residential turf, pastures, and commercial landscape beds. Technicians distribute slow-acting metabolic inhibitor granular baits across open turf areas using calibrated broadcast equipment, allowing foraging worker ants to collect and feed the active compound to the reproductive queen. Severe satellite mounds situated along structural foundations, electrical transformer pads, and swimming pool pump slabs receive direct pressurized botanical or non-repellent liquid drenches to achieve immediate colony collapse without causing mound splitting.

Buyer's guide

How to choose the right pro

Selecting the correct remediation approach requires matching the specific pest biology and structural design of your property against targeted intervention methods. If you are experiencing visible foraging insects such as German cockroaches, silverfish, or indoor ant trails within food preparation spaces, choose an intensive interior crack-and-crevice cleanout utilizing precision gel baits and insect growth regulators. If your primary concern is preventing seasonal outdoor invaders such as striped bark scorpions, American cockroaches, or millipedes from entering living quarters during peak summer droughts, choose a multi-zone exterior microencapsulated perimeter defense combined with physical weep-hole screening. The trade-off is that interior-only applications resolve isolated harborage pockets but leave exterior perimeters vulnerable to continuous re-infestation, whereas exterior barrier defenses require regular quarterly reapplication to survive South Texas ultraviolet exposure and thermal breakdown. For subterranean termite management, if your structure rests on an active fault line or expansive Houston black clay with frequent foundation shifting, choose non-repellent liquid soil trenching combined with targeted expansion-joint injections rather than localized surface spot sprays. The trade-off is a higher initial investment in excavation and sub-slab drilling versus the severe financial risk of undetected structural framing damage. When dealing with attic noises or rodent gnawing, if you seek a permanent biological resolution, choose full structural exclusion and mechanical trapping over continuous open-air rodenticide bait stations. The trade-off involves higher upfront craftsmanship costs to seal high-elevation roofline junctions, soffits, and fascia gaps, but eliminates the risk of secondary wildlife toxicity and decaying animal carcasses within inaccessible wall voids. For yard-wide vector management involving mosquitoes and biting midges, property owners must choose between automated micro-fine misting circuits and manual monthly foliage surface barrier treatments; automated misting provides consistent automated suppression across dense brush lines but demands ongoing mechanical maintenance, while scheduled manual treatments offer flexible seasonal targeting directly timed to South Texas rainfall events.

San Antonio features a complex ecological intersection where the rocky, porous limestone strata of the Edwards Plateau to the north meets the dense, shifting Houston black clay soils of the southern Blackland Prairies. This distinct regional geology creates extreme, localized pest dynamics throughout Bexar County. In northern communities like Stone Oak, The Dominion, and Timberwood Park, extensive bedrock outcroppings, fractured limestone ledges, and caliche soil formations provide undisturbed subterranean harborage for high densities of striped bark scorpions, red imported fire ants, and subterranean termites. During the intense triple-digit heat and extended drought conditions typical of South Texas summers between June and August, outdoor moisture reservoirs vanish, driving these resilient crawling arthropods directly toward residential foundations, irrigated lawn borders, and interior air-conditioned spaces through masonry weep holes. Conversely, historic districts such as King William, Monte Vista, and Alamo Heights feature classic pier-and-beam architecture, sprawling live oak canopies, and mature landscape root networks that foster elevated humidity levels. These environmental conditions maintain high populations of smokybrown and American cockroaches, carpenter ants, and roof rats that forage along interconnected tree branches and enter older wood-framed rooflines, fascia boards, and crawlspaces. Furthermore, the expansive clay soils prevalent around Westover Hills and the Medical Center undergo dramatic shrink-swell cycles following heavy spring thunderstorm downpours along the Salado Creek and Leon Creek watersheds, producing visible structural foundation settling, masonry cracking, and perimeter soil gaps. These structural shifts create direct subterranean entry portals that allow Eastern subterranean and Formosan termites to bypass surface barriers and access structural sill plates. Standardized surface spray routines fail under these severe geographic and climatic demands; lasting biological protection requires structural exclusion protocols, UV-stable formulations, and deep sub-slab treatments specifically engineered for San Antonio architecture and Bexar County soil chemistry.

How quickly will pest activity stop after an initial treatment in San Antonio?
Visible foraging insect activity decreases significantly within 24 to 48 hours following an initial perimeter knockdown, while complete colony eradication occurs across a 7 to 14 day biological window as non-repellent active ingredients and insect growth regulators circulate through the nest.
Are pest control products safe for pets and children in San Antonio homes?
All interior applications are applied strictly as targeted crack-and-crevice treatments, non-volatile gel baits, or enclosed wall void injections, ensuring that materials dry thoroughly and remain completely inaccessible to children and domestic pets under standard living conditions.
Do San Antonio properties require locked-in annual pest control contracts?
Property owners are never forced into locked-in long-term contracts; standalone corrective treatments resolve acute infestations, while ongoing quarterly perimeter defense remains an optional preventative program designed to maintain continuous exterior barrier protection against seasonal pest migrations.
Why are subterranean termites such a severe threat to San Antonio foundations?
Subterranean termites exploit the natural fissures in Bexar County limestone and shrinkage gaps in expansive clay soils, constructing hidden mud shelter tubes over foundation slab edges and through plumbing cutouts to consume interior structural wood framing completely undetected.
How do summer heat spikes affect scorpion and roach intrusions in San Antonio?
Intense triple-digit summer temperatures dry out natural exterior soil beds and leaf litter, compelling striped bark scorpions and large wood roaches to seek the moisture and cooler temperatures found along foundation weep holes, plumbing traps, and indoor baseboards.
What is the difference between chemical perimeter spraying and structural exclusion in San Antonio?
Chemical perimeter spraying creates a temporary liquid barrier that neutralizes foraging insects upon direct contact, whereas structural exclusion physically seals architectural entry points using galvanized mesh, metal flashing, and elastomeric sealants to permanently prevent pest ingress.
How do roof rats gain access to San Antonio attics, and what prevents their return?
Roof rats exploit mature tree branches overhanging rooflines, utility cables, and rough brick masonry to climb onto roofs, entering attics through uncapped ridge vents, damaged soffits, and plumbing stack flashings; permanent prevention requires sealing every roofline opening with heavy-gauge galvanized steel mesh.
How does expansive clay soil in San Antonio compromise termite barriers over time?
Expansive clay soils swell during heavy rainfall and shrink severely during summer droughts, pulling away from concrete foundation edges and creating mechanical fractures in continuous liquid termiticide barriers that foraging termite workers can easily penetrate.
What steps are involved in treating a German cockroach infestation in a San Antonio kitchen?
Remediation requires removing food sources, applying targeted non-repellent matrix baits into interior cabinet framework and motor housings, injecting insect growth regulators into wall voids to halt reproductive cycles, and performing follow-up assessments at 14-day intervals until all nymphal stages are eliminated.
Why are striped bark scorpions common in northern San Antonio neighborhoods like Stone Oak?
Northern San Antonio sits atop rocky Edwards Plateau limestone shelves, where fractured stone beds and native cedar brakes create ideal natural harborage zones for scorpions that subsequently migrate into adjacent residential developments.
What preparation is required before an exterior perimeter pest treatment in San Antonio?
Homeowners should ensure clear access to foundation walls by trimming dense vegetation back 12 inches from exterior masonry, clearing personal belongings or pet toys from patio perimeters, and keeping domestic pets indoors until liquid barrier products dry completely.
